Jeremiah 23:1-2
The Righteous Branch
Woe to the shepherds(Pastors) who destroy and scatter the sheep(people) of My pasture!(kingdom) says the Lord.
Therefore thus says the Lord God of Israel against the shepherds(Pastors) that feed My people: You have scattered My flock(people) and driven them away and have not visited them.(never cared for them) I am about to punish you for the evil of your deeds, says the Lord.
The first group to be judged on that day is the group of Pastors, as Pastors we have a responsibility that is more important than of any man on earth. To care for your own soul is the most hardest task ever, now taking care of more than 20 souls/sheep is something else having to feed them, making sure that they understand careful what you feeding them, it's hard yes. But God has given us ability to do so, He provides us with daily strength to take care of His people more over He gives us a book of instructions of how to take care of those He place in our watch which is the Bible. So don't have any excuses to make after all.
The Bible has it all, but we sometimes wanna put our focus on things out of the Bible or rather we use what's on the Bible and interpret it to prove our own statement to be right hence God was using that certain script for His own interpretation. Some use there scripts to ; raise funds, humiliate other people, to buy the faces of the VIPs of their domination or to even creat name for themselves forgetting that all this that they're doing they are poisoning those who listens to them preach. Later on you find in the church they're those who don't speak to others they are fights of position like theres no order at all. Well I always say; if the head is lost so is the body. If the Pastor himself is not well with God his people will suffer too because they feed from him.
Pastors I know we human bound to make mistakes but a mistake we can't afford to commit is to try and lead the church by our own experience.
